Guest guest Posted March 31, 2007 Report Share Posted March 31, 2007 Electronic Records Express http://www.ssa.gov/ere/ Electronic Records Express is an initiative by Social Security and state Disability Determination Services (DDS) to offer electronic options for submitting health and school records related to disability claims. When you receive a request for health or school records or other information about a person who has applied for Social Security disability benefits, you can choose the method of sending the information that works best for you: online to Social Security's secure website; or by fax to your state DDS or to Social Security. The records you send are automatically associated with the applicant's unique disability claim folder.
